  11. For food that gets stuck especially chicken, pick up some papaya enzymes and chew 2. Helps the stuck food pass. You can get these at any vitamin store.
  12. Don't mix the shake until you get through security. You have to buy water on the other side. I had 14 packets of protein shake and all my nuts too. They are concerned with liquids. Once you pass through buy a water and shake away. Glad I could help.
  13. I'm waiting for a plane to arrive home from vacation. I bought syntrax nectar singles protein shakes for airplane. They mix with water. I got lemonade, iced tea, fuzzy navel a bunch of variety singles. Also individual packages of almonds made by emerald. Protein bar by think thin chunky peanut butter. Hope this helps.
